Permanently Removing the DVR Expander

Under normal operating conditions, there is no reason to remove the DVR Expander. Removing the DVR
Expander does not allow you to play your recordings on a different DVR. Because each recording is distributed
equally between the DVR’s internal drive and the DVR Expander, you cannot gain additional storage by using
more than one DVR Expander. You should only remove the DVR Expander if you wish to stop using it.

1. Power off the compatible TiVo

®

DVR by disconnecting the AC power cord.

2. Disconnect the AC adapter cord and eSATA cable from the DVR Expander.
3. Plug in the DVR's power cord and follow the onscreen instructions.

Temporarily Disconnecting the DVR Expander
Follow these instructions when temporarily disconnecting the DVR Expander (to clean or move your
entertainment center, for example).

1. Power off the compatible TiVo

®

DVR by disconnecting the AC power cord.

2. Disconnect the AC adapter cord and eSATA cable from the DVR Expander.

Reconnecting the DVR Expander after Temporary Disconnection

1. Reconnect the AC adapter cord and eSATA cable to the DVR Expander.
2. Power on the TiVo

®

DVR by reattaching the AC power cord.

CAUTION: If you permanently remove the DVR Expander, you will lose all or most of your existing recordings
on both the DVR and the DVR Expander.

CAUTION: Always unplug the power cord from the electrical outlet before disconnecting the AC adapter
from the DVR Expander.
